Subject: Key rotation for the autocomplete index

Hi — welcome aboard! Quick heads-up: we rotated credentials for Swiftlet, our (admittedly sluggish) autocomplete index service, this morning. Old keys stop working Friday. While we chase down the latency issue, you'll need the new key to query staging. Paste it into your local env file; it's right here.

gateway credential: kto3_qfe

TICKET: Staging exports off by five hours.

The Fernwick report exporter in staging had `EXPORT_TZ` unset, so everything defaulted to the container zone instead of UTC. Fixed `EXPORT_TZ=UTC` and `TZ_STRICT=1` in `.env.staging`. Exports now match prod. Remaining issue: the export-signing credential was also missing, which broke checksum verification downstream. Adding it back now; the signing secret goes on the line directly below this note.

vault entry, hahaf-tafog: VAULT_KEY3=38a

Changelog — SheetHerder CSV wizard, defaults changed. Heads up, new folks: delimiter sniffing is now on by default, header row detection got stricter, and the max preview rows jumped to 500. Old imports still work; saved presets are untouched. If something looks off, compare your setup against the new defaults below.

config for taguf-tafof:
zorath:
  log_level: error
  metrics_host: metrics.zorath.zemvarlabs.internal
  pin: 5550
  pool_size: 32

## Runbook: PixMolt batch resize failures

When the PixMolt CLI reports stalled batch jobs, first check the queue depth on the Carradine worker pool. If depth exceeds 500, drain the pool and restart the resize workers in order: thumbnails, previews, full-size. Re-run the failed batch with the `--resume` flag so completed images are skipped. All runbook commands hit the internal PixMolt control API, which requires authentication on every call. Use the on-call operator key that follows for these operations.

app token of yagaf-bahop = vxb2-4d